Porsche Ventures
ActiveOverview
Porsche Ventures is the venture capital arm of Porsche AG, founded in 2016, that invests in early- to growth-stage startups globally, focusing on mobility, industrial technology, sustainability, customer experience, and digital lifestyles.123 It operates from offices in Europe (Stuttgart and Berlin), the US (Silicon Valley/Palo Alto), Israel, and China, combining financial investments with industry expertise, mentorship, and strategic partnerships.34 The firm holds stakes in about 30 companies, including investments in AI, blockchain, AR/VR, and has achieved exits like evopark and Fleetonomy.1
History
Porsche Ventures was established in 2016 as the venture capital arm of Porsche AG to make strategic investments in early- and growth-phase companies.13 It has since built a portfolio of around 30 stakes worldwide, with key investments in firms like Rimac Automobili, TriEye, Anagog, Urgent.ly, WayRay, and VAHA.1 Successful exits include digital parking service evopark and fleet management firm Fleetonomy.1 The firm expanded its presence to six locations including North America, Europe, Israel, and China, and invests in VC funds such as Eventures, Magma, and Grove.14 As of late 2025, it launched Porsche Ventures II fund.5
Notable Products
- Investment in Rimac Automobili - Partnership with technology and sports car company focused on electric hypercars and mobility tech.
- Investment in TriEye - Israeli startup developing advanced imaging sensors for automotive safety.
- Investment in Urgent.ly - Platform providing mobility and roadside assistance services.
- Investment in WayRay - Swiss specialists in head-up display and holographic technologies.
- Investment in evopark (exit) - Digital parking service that achieved successful exit.
- Porsche Ventures II - New fund launched in November 2025 for continued investments.
